So the ideas I've liked so far are:

-Raise player salary floor(slightly)
-Decreases in attendance for consecutive blowout losses
-or Decreased attendance for consecutive large losses while having large profits/cash reserves
-A more accurate fan survey

Another idea to somewhat balance the whole thing is giving financial bonuses for winning teams. Say each team gets a certain reward per game won (similiar to the cup rewards) and/or also a prize for the league finish at the end. Giving detailed numbers here would not make sense, since only the BB developers have insight into what the teams in different league levels earn per week.

The other stuff you said is great.

The financial rewards can be amended by modifying the fan survey. Winning teams over a period of time get more bums on seats.

From the fan survey: The general manager is doing everything he can to try to improve the team This shouldn't just be about the frequency with which a manager makes bids on the TL or whatever that question is supposed to address.

Have multiple blowout losses (at least 50 points) devastate the score for that one, as well as severely reducing the positive response for the question: I am pleased with the team's performance this season." I'm sure it's been said already but I don't want to read this whole thread.

Would make sense given the current wording, would hurt those annoying tankers, and the BB's wouldn't have to add any new questions to the survey.
